Universities nearby 30 Dingwall Rd, Croydon CR0 2NB, United Kingdom

BPP Croydon

Approximately 0.48 km away
Address: Tolley House, 2 Addiscombe Rd, Croydon CR0 5TT, UK

Coombe Cliff Cets Centre

Approximately 1.17 km away
Address: Croydon, Greater London, United Kingdom

London School of Law and Management

Approximately 1.62 km away
Address: 505 London Rd, Croydon, Thornton Heath CR7 6AR, UK